Next, in order to calculate your monthly mortgage insurance premium, the following will be needed:. Home purchase price — When all other variables stay fixed, the higher the home purchase price, the higher your private mortgage insurance will be.

This is because the mortgage insurance rate is multiplied by the loan amount to find your annual mortgage insurance. For the same down payment, a higher home purchase price means that the loan amount will be bigger, and this exposes the lender to more risk, therefore the private mortgage insurance premiums will be higher as well.

Mortgage Insurance Rate — As mentioned above, the mortgage insurance rate is multiplied by the loan amount to find out the premium. A higher mortgage insurance rate means that you will pay a bigger amount on private mortgage insurance. Down Payment — The down payment you make is deducted from the home purchase price to find out how much financing you will need from the lender.

Therefore, lenders turn to private mortgage insurance companies to assume some of that risk. The coverage a private mortgage insurance company offers determines what portion of the amount lost the lender will be able to recover in the case that the borrower defaults on their mortgage.

This can help supplement the amount recovered from a foreclosure. Higher coverage means that the borrower will pay higher insurance premiums.

When the lender is lending a lot of money to the borrower and there is a high risk of default, the lender can agree to lend if they are protected by a greater insurance coverage.
